Sophos is a global leader and innovator of advanced security solutions for defeating cyberattacks. The company acquired Secureworks in February 2025, bringing together two pioneers that have redefined the cybersecurity industry with their innovative, native AI-optimized services, technologies and products. Sophos is now the largest pure-play Managed Detection and Response (MDR) provider, supporting more than 28,000 organizations.

In addition to MDR and other services, Sophos' complete portfolio includes industry-leading endpoint, network, email, and cloud security that interoperate and adapt to defend through the Sophos Central platform. Secureworks provides the innovative, market-leading Taegis XDR/MDR, identity threat detection and response (ITDR), next-gen SIEM capabilities, managed risk, and a comprehensive set of advisory services. Sophos sells all these solutions through reseller partners, Managed Service Providers (MSPs) and Managed Security Service Providers (MSSPs) worldwide, defending more than 600,000 organizations from phishing, ransomware, data theft, and other everyday and state-sponsored cybercrimes.

The solutions are powered by historical and real-time threat intelligence from Sophos X-Ops and the newly added Counter Threat Unit (CTU). Sophos is headquartered in Oxford, U.K.

Role Summary

We are seeking a detail-oriented and technically skilled Detection Engineer to join our X-OPS team. In this role, you will be responsible for analyzing advanced security threats—ranging from malware to complex web attacks—and translating threat intelligence into high-fidelity detections across our platform. Your work will help ensure our analysts and clients receive highly accurate, actionable alerts with minimal noise.

You will leverage data from over 40 third-party and internal sources, partner with our CTU Threat Intelligence team, and use a range of scripting and automation tools to strengthen detection capabilities. The ideal candidate is a hands-on security practitioner with a deep understanding of endpoint behaviour, cloud behaviour, and detection development who thrives in fast-paced, technical environments.

What You Will Do

  • Develop countermeasures to detect advanced threats based on research and intelligence from the CTU team.
  • Analyze endpoint behaviours and logs to design detections using multi-source telemetry.
  • Continuously refine and monitor detection rules to optimize the signal-to-noise ratio for alerts.
  • Research and implement alert handling for new device ingestions, ensuring high-value signal delivery.
  • Leverage internal tooling to distinguish native from standard integrations for detection accuracy.
  • Collaborate on the development of internal tools, automation, and detection infrastructure.
  • Act as a subject matter expert across departments including Product Management, Marketing, and Labs Research.

What You Will Bring

  • Strong passion for cybersecurity research and the ability to quickly learn emerging technologies.
  • Hands-on experience in scripting languages (PowerShell, Bash, Python) and use of Python data science libraries (e.g., NumPy, Pandas, Matplotlib).
  • Knowledge of CI/CD pipelines, testing frameworks, and automation principles.
  • Proficiency in analyzing logs from firewalls, proxies, and security infrastructure to identify anomalies.
  • Familiarity with event logs, traffic pattern anomalies, and threat hunting methodologies.
  • Strong understanding of endpoint detection, Linux/Unix and Windows OS internals, vulnerability identification, and workflow automation.
  • Forensic analysis of memory and disk images across various OS and file system types is a plus.
  • Experience in malware analysis, including static/dynamic techniques and reverse engineering (IA32/64, ARM binaries) is a plus.
  • Experience with event correlation and incident reconstruction using log data is a plus.
  • Network traffic analysis skills, including identification of anomalous or malicious traits is a plus.
  • Solid grasp of database querying, systems architecture, and process automation for operational improvements is a nice to have.
